This nonwoven fabric's moisture-transferring properties have also made it a popular textile for cold weather gear. For instance, this synthetic was used to make the underwear and undershirts that were used in the first generation of the U.S. Army's Extended Cold Weather Clothing System (ECWCS). It was found that garments made from this fabric improved the comfort of soldiers in cold-weather conditions, but problems with polypro fabrics have caused the United States military to switch to the latest generation of polyester textiles for their Generation II and Generation III ECWCS systems. Phillips Petroleum chemists J. Paul Hogan and Robert Banks first demonstrated the polymerization of propylene in 1951. [4] The stereoselective polymerization to the isotactic was discovered by Giulio Natta and Karl Rehn in March 1954. [5] This pioneering discovery led to large-scale commercial production of isotactic polypropylene by the Italian firm Montecatini from 1957 onwards. [6] Syndiotactic polypropylene was also first synthesized by Natta. Interest in polypropylene development is ongoing to the present. For example, making polypropylene from bio-based resources is a topic of interest in the 21st century. PP is highly inert to chemicals and is suitable as fishing nets and geotextiles in alkaline and acidic soils. PES on the other hand loses its strength in alkaline soils and should not be used. Leaching also takes place with polyester in aqueous solution leading to loss in strength.

Polypropylene belongs to the group of polyolefins and is partially crystalline and non-polar. Its properties are similar to polyethylene, but it is slightly harder and more heat-resistant. It is a white, mechanically rugged material and has a high chemical resistance. [1] The density of PP is between 0.895 and 0.93g/cm 3. Therefore, PP is the commodity plastic with the lowest density. With lower density, moldings parts with lower weight and more parts of a certain mass of plastic can be produced. Unlike polyethylene, crystalline and amorphous regions differ only slightly in their density. However, the density of polyethylene can significantly change with fillers. [8] :24
